Common use of Successors and Third Parties Clause in Contracts

Successors and Third Parties. This Agreement and the rights and obligations hereunder shall bind and inure to the benefit of the parties hereto and their successors and assigns. The rights and benefits hereunder are specific to the parties and shall not be delegated or assigned without the prior written consent of the other party, which shall not be unreasonably withheld. Nothing in this Agreement is intended to create or grant any right, privilege or other benefit to or for any person or entity other than the parties hereto and any party executing a Purchaser Joinder Agreement. Notwithstanding the foregoing, the Bank may assign its rights hereunder without Purchaser’s consent.
